docker compose 最新版本
时间: 2024-01-19 11:18:47 浏览: 32
以下是安装最新版本的docker-compose的步骤:
1. 下载最新版本的docker-compose二进制文件:
```shell
curl -SL https://github.com/docker/compose/releases/latest/download/docker-compose-Linux-x86_64 -o /usr/local/bin/docker-compose
```
2. 赋予执行权限:
```shell
sudo chmod +x /usr/local/bin/docker-compose
```
3. 创建软链接:
```shell
sudo ln -s /usr/local/bin/docker-compose /usr/bin/docker-compose
```
4. 验证安装:
```shell
docker-compose version
```
这样就成功安装了最新版本的docker-compose。
相关问题
docker-compose 最新版本
Docker Compose是一个用于定义和运行Docker应用程序的工具。它允许开发人员使用YAML文件来配置多个容器,创建一个完整的应用程序环境。
Docker Compose的最新版本是3。版本3引入了许多新的功能和改进,使得使用Docker Compose更加方便和强大。
首先,版本3支持多个网络。以前的版本只支持默认网络,而版本3允许开发人员在应用程序中定义自己的网络。这使得容器间的通信更加灵活,并且可以更好地组织和管理容器。
其次,版本3引入了服务扩展。这意味着现在可以使用Docker Compose来扩展一个服务的实例数量。只需在docker-compose.yaml文件中定义所需的实例数,并使用命令"docker-compose up --scale <service-name>=<number-of-instances>"即可实现服务的扩展。
此外,版本3还加入了对Docker配置文件的支持。现在,可以在docker-compose.yaml文件中直接指定Docker的配置文件,而不需要使用额外的命令。
最后,版本3还引入了一些新的命令和选项,使得使用Docker Compose更加方便和灵活。例如,现在可以使用"docker-compose down"命令停止并删除应用程序环境,使用"--build"选项重新构建镜像,以及使用"--no-cache"选项避免使用缓存。
总之,Docker Compose的最新版本是3,它引入了许多新的功能和改进,使得使用Docker Compose更加方便和强大。开发人员可以使用YAML文件来定义和运行多个容器,创建一个完整的应用程序环境,并且可以方便地扩展服务的实例数量、使用Docker配置文件以及执行其他方便的命令和选项。
docker compose的版本
Docker Compose是一个用于定义和运行多个Docker容器的工具。它使用YAML文件来配置应用程序的服务、网络和卷等方面的设置。Docker Compose有两个主要版本:1.x和2.x。
1.x版本是早期的版本,使用的是基于Python的Compose文件格式。它支持的功能相对较少,但仍然可以满足一般的容器编排需求。
2.x版本是较新的版本,使用的是基于Docker标准的Compose文件格式。它引入了一些新的功能和语法,例如服务扩展、网络别名和依赖关系等。2.x版本还支持使用Docker Swarm进行集群管理。
总结一下,Docker Compose有两个主要版本:1.x和2.x。1.x版本使用Python格式的Compose文件,功能相对较少;2.x版本使用Docker标准的Compose文件格式,引入了一些新的功能和语法。
相关推荐
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)